De Blasio Acts on School Integration, but Others Lead Charge

Posted on

“Mayor Bill de Blasio stepped into the school desegregation debate on Thursday, by approving a plan to diversify middle schools in one of the city’s 32 school districts and granting $2 million to help other districts come up with their own plans, but the small scale of the actions highlighted just how much he has followed on the issue rather than led. The plan was created not by City Hall or even the Department of Education, but by parents in District 15, which includes the Brooklyn neighborhoods of Park Slope, Sunset Park and Red Hook.”
